Newcastle have been handed a boost ahead of Wednesday night, as PSV Eindhoven will be missing Arjen Robben, Theo Lucius and Kevin Hofland.
An MRI scan on Robben revealed that he has suffered a three centimetre tear to his hamstring. Such an injury would normally rule a player out for the rest of the season, but Robben is still hoping to make Euro 2004.
"The European Championships start in six weeks time," Robben told PSV's website. "I think that I will be totally fit then."
Both Lucius and Hofland failed final fitness tests on Monday. Lucius will be sidelined through a hamstring injury, while defender Hofland is out due to knee problems.
PSV's Andre Ooijer and Ernest Faber are also struggling with injuries and could yet miss the game.
